Thrill of the dance

THE TALENT was bubbling over at Frank Collymore Hall Saturday night at the performing arts semi-finals of the National Independence Festival of Creative Arts.

Whether it was theatre, dance or music, the sold-out audience soaked up all the thrills and treats on show at Combermere School.

Among those who stood out were the young dancers of the Pinelands Creative Workshop.

Here, some of the dancers keeping form as they sparkled during their presentaion titled Limbo. (Picture by Ricardo Leacock.)
